The Growth Hormone Releasing Peptide, in Plain Words

You might be curious about treatments that can potentially help your body function more optimally as you age. This specific therapy utilizes a synthetic peptide that closely mimics a natural hormone produced by your pituitary gland. It signals your body to release its own growth hormone in a pulsatile manner, similar to how it functions during younger years.

This GHRH analog works by stimulating the anterior pituitary gland. Increased growth hormone levels can, in turn, influence the liver to produce more IGF-1. IGF-1 plays a crucial role in cellular repair, muscle growth, and metabolic function. Many people report experiencing benefits like improved sleep patterns, enhanced recovery from exercise, and a general increase in their energy levels.

The compounded prescription is tailored to individual needs, requiring careful medical assessment. It is not a universal solution but rather a targeted approach for specific physiological goals. You should understand that this treatment is not FDA-approved for general use but is compounded by licensed pharmacies under specific federal guidelines.

Understanding the Mechanism of Action

You may wonder precisely how this peptide operates within your body. It acts as a potent GHRH analog, designed to be more stable and longer-lasting than natural GHRH. By binding to specific receptors on pituitary cells, it effectively triggers a cascade that leads to increased secretion of growth hormone.

This pulsatile release is significant because it mimics the body’s natural rhythm, which is crucial for preventing tachyphylaxis and maintaining receptor sensitivity. Unlike direct growth hormone administration, this method encourages your body’s intrinsic hormonal production. This distinction is important for long-term physiological support.

The resulting increase in growth hormone then stimulates the liver to produce IGF-1. This hormone is a key mediator for many of growth hormone’s anabolic and metabolic effects. These effects can translate into improved protein synthesis, enhanced fat metabolism, and better cellular regeneration. You might notice this through improved muscle tone, increased energy, and better wound healing. The entire process is designed to support your body’s innate capacity for renewal and vitality.

What patients typically report

Sermorelin works on a slow curve because it asks the body to make its own growth hormone. Results compound over months, not days. A typical reported timeline looks like this.

Adult relaxing at home checking telehealth treatment progress on a smartphone
  1. Weeks 1 to 4

    Deeper sleep is usually the first signal. Morning energy lifts. Recovery from training feels faster. No measurable body composition change yet.

  2. Weeks 5 to 8

    Skin texture, hair quality and nail strength tend to shift. Mental clarity in the afternoon improves. Strength on lifts often goes up.

  3. Weeks 9 to 12

    Body composition starts moving, with a typical 5 to 10 percent fat reduction reported alongside small lean mass gains. Libido and joint comfort improve.

  4. Month 4 and beyond

    A follow-up IGF-1 lab is drawn. Dose is adjusted up or down. Many patients maintain on a lower dose after this point.
